NEED HONDA GURU HELP, ect problem
so first off..the car is a 89 crx HF with a obd0 b16 swap. i did a search and i found the info on the faq about getting a resistor and plugging it in to see if the problem is with the sensor or the wiring. well i got the resistor (330 ohm 1/2 watt spec, or one from Radio Shack part# 271-1113) and i still get a cel and bad idle.
i also have the factory service manual for the crx and i went through the process of testing with a multimeter. and the wiring seems to be alright. i get 5v's on the red wire and i get 5v's between both ect wires. i finally broke down and bought a new ect and tried that....still getting a cel!!!!
one thing that did turn the cel off was when i restarted the car after it was already warmed up...i guess because the car doesn't look at the ect after its warm? i'm not sure. can anyone help??
